A random group of students was selected from a large student conference to analyze their class in school. Is there evidence to reject the hypothesis that the number of students is equally distributed between the four classes, at α=0.05?\alpha = 0.05 ?
 Year in school  Freshman  Sophomore  Junior  Senior  Number of students 12121323\begin{array} { l c c c c } \text { Year in school } & \text { Freshman } & \text { Sophomore } & \text { Junior } & \text { Senior } \\ \text { Number of students } & 12 & 12 & 13 & 23 \end{array}
